Failure on the second floor ...!

In the British city of St. Petersburg (Peterborough) driver on the car Volvo, flying through the air in a car about 30 meters, broke the wall of apartment on the second floor of an apartment house. According to Daily Mail, 31-year-old Mr. Gordon lost control at the roundabout and left at the fence. Jumping up on the curb, the car struck first on the lawn, and then jumped up again, slammed into the wall at home on the second floor.





19-year-old Laura Stevens, whose car flew into the room, out of it for a few seconds before the accident. However, according to her mother, Laura is now afraid to go to his bedroom - she has never visited it since the incident.

As one of the firemen involved in analysis of the dam and "taking out" the machine out of the apartment, "we have already dealt with cars crashed into the building, but still none of them did not reach the second floor."
